The Thermo LTQ Orbitrap Discovery with HCD (Higher-energy Collisional Dissociation) is a high-resolution, high-accuracy mass spectrometer designed for advanced proteomics, metabolomics, and biomarker discovery applications. Combining Orbitrap mass analysis with LTQ linear ion trap functionality and HCD fragmentation, this system delivers precise identification and quantification of peptides, proteins, and small molecules with unmatched sensitivity and reproducibility.
Key Features
- High-resolution Orbitrap mass analyzer for accurate mass measurements.
- LTQ linear ion trap for fast MS/MS acquisition.
- HCD (Higher-energy Collisional Dissociation) for detailed peptide fragmentation.
- Integrated LC-MS/MS compatibility for seamless workflows.
- Advanced software for method development, data acquisition, and analysis.
- Rugged design for high-throughput proteomics and metabolomics workflows.
- Wide dynamic range for sensitive quantification of low-abundance analytes.
Applications / Use Cases
- Comprehensive proteomics studies including protein identification and quantification.
- Targeted and untargeted metabolomics research.
- Biomarker discovery for clinical and pharmaceutical research.
- Post-translational modification analysis (e.g., phosphorylation, glycosylation).
- High-throughput small molecule and peptide analysis in research and industry.
